Abstract
System (2) for handling a first component (4), comprising: a main-device (8) and a module-device (10), wherein the module-device (10) comprises a pressing section (22) being arranged to form an outer surface of the module-device (10), wherein the module-device (10) is adapted for releasably receiving the first component (4), such that a connection section (12) of the first component (4) is releasably, in particular planar, attachable to the pressing section (22) of the module-device (10), wherein the module-device (10) is configured to be releasably connected to a second component (6), wherein the main-device (8) comprises a grabbing unit (26), which is adapted for releasably connecting the module-device (10), such that the pressing section (22) is arranged to form a first outer surface section of the main-device (8), and wherein the main-device (8) comprises a connector (36), in particular a connector plate, adapted for being connected to a handling-unit, in particular a robot, for arranging the main-device (8) at the second component (6), such that the connection section (12) of the first component (4), if attached to the pressing section (22) of the module-device (10), is at least indirectly attachable to a front surface (38) of the second component (6). The present disclosure further relates to a method for ahdesively connecting a first component (4) to a second component (6) by means of the system (2).
